I need a new video card for sure. The on-board BS in this computer isn't handling starcraft 2 all that well. Anyone care to share some knowledge of modest priced video cards that will handle SC2?
You can get a used 9800GT for about 50$, works great for me. New is 80$.
Depends on what you consider modest. Would suggest something in the 2xx series of GeForce, but that might be more than your opinion on what modest is.

I've got a laptop with a 9800M GTS, and it will play fine at 1080P. I also have a laptop with a GTX280M, and it will play at ultra settings at 900P, but I turn it down to medium if I'm playing some of the custom, unit-spamming maps.
The Home Theater PC I built for my GF's family will even play it at 60fps with medium-low settings at 900P with a $40 HD 4350.
So basically, if you've got a discrete graphics card that was released in the last 4 years, you can probably play SC2 fine.
